Well to repeat
something that I may have said before, I prefer the Botswanan school year to
that in Canada.
Here they have
roughly 3 equal terms starting the school year in January, after the Christmas
holidays/break.
Approximately 12
weeks of school, then a month off for the Easter holidays (April); Back to
school for 12 weeks and then another 4-week break in August; finally, a 3rd
semester of 12 weeks and then a Christmas break for all of December.
Thus, not one long
extended summer break which in Canada is way too long. Better to have even terms with nice breaks in
between. Easier to plan holidays and
trips and to avoid the 1-week March Break scramble. As well, end of school year exams in fact
come at the year end. Crazy to have the
first semester of Canadian high schools extend into January and then exams.
I think it is high
time consideration in Canada is given to a more balanced school year.
